Greenwood student wins national award for essay
Greenwood High School student Julie Hansbrough is one of only three winners nationwide in the sixth annual Essentially Ellington Essay Contest sponsored by the Jazz at Lincoln Center organization. Hansbrough took third-place honors in this year's contest, finishing behind Alex Dugdale of Seattle and Jon Morgenstern of Mamaroneck, New York. Each year, the Essentially Ellington Essay Contest invites students to submit a 500-word essay describing an experience that led to their love for jazz. Submissions are reviewed by jazz expert and writer Dan Morgenstern, and the winning essayist wins a trip to New York City to attend the Essentially Ellington High School Jazz Band Competition and Festival in May. All three winners also receive a collection of prizes -- including CDs, subscription to a jazz publication, Jazz at Lincoln Center gear, books, and scores for their high school band directors.
